concept.one positions itself as an “AI agency for B2B companies.” Based on the scraped page content, it supports clients in moving projects forward by combining “AI expertise” with classic agency experience. The available information makes it look more like a service-based AI consulting/agency firm than a standardized SaaS tool or an AI product that users can sign up for and use directly.
The page does not disclose specific AI capabilities or models, such as whether it uses large language models, image generation, marketing automation, data analytics, chatbots, or enterprise knowledge bases. Therefore, we can only confirm that its service direction is AI-related and focused on B2B company projects. Typical use cases may include enterprise AI project consulting, marketing-related project support, or AI implementation, but the page does not provide customer cases, industry scenarios, or delivery methodology, so these cannot be further verified.
The page does not mention free quotas, trial options, package pricing, project-based quotes, or subscription fees, nor does it specify supported payment methods. There is also no public information about APIs, third-party system integrations, CRM/marketing tool connections, or similar capabilities. Companies that want to quickly assess cost and technical accessibility will still need to contact the provider directly.
The main advantage is its clear positioning: it serves B2B companies and emphasizes a mix of AI capabilities and traditional agency experience, which may be valuable for businesses that need integrated support across communication, strategy, and execution. The downside is that very little information is disclosed. There are no details on models, processes, case studies, privacy and compliance, pricing, or delivery boundaries, making it difficult to judge its depth of expertise and value for money.
It is better suited to B2B companies looking for AI marketing or project agency support in Germany or the broader European market, especially customers willing to define customized projects through consultation.
